What is a DTS specialist?

DTS (Defense Travel System) specialists are professionals responsible for managing and facilitating travel arrangements within the U.S. Department of Defense. They assist military and civilian personnel with travel authorizations, voucher processing, and ensuring compliance with government travel regulations. These specialists provide guidance on DTS software, resolve travel-related issues, and ensure timely reimbursement for official travel expenses. Their role is crucial for maintaining efficient and accurate travel operations within defense organizations.

Position Summary
The Quality Manager will be responsible for developing, implementing, and maintaining all project quality assurance and quality control activities. This position requires strong leadership skills and hands-on experience managing quality teams, client expectations, inspections, audits, reporting, and compliance requirements throughout the project lifecycle.
Key Responsibilities
  • Develop, implement, and manage the project QA/QC program.
  • Lead and supervise quality personnel, inspectors, and support staff.
  • Manage a quality team of three or more direct reports.
  • Establish project quality objectives, procedures, and performance metrics.
  • Coordinate inspections, audits, testing activities, and corrective actions.
  • Ensure compliance with project specifications, industry standards, client requirements, and regulatory guidelines.
  • Review quality documentation, reports, procedures, and inspection records.
  • Collaborate with project management, construction teams, subcontractors, and client representatives.
  • Investigate quality issues and implement corrective and preventive actions.
  • Monitor project quality performance and identify continuous improvement opportunities.
  • Prepare and present quality reports to project leadership and clients.
Required Qualifications
  • Minimum 5+ years of Quality Management experience.
  • Experience managing QA/QC personnel with at least 3 direct reports.
  • Proven experience developing, implementing, and managing comprehensive QA/QC programs.
  • Strong knowledge of construction quality systems, inspections, audits, and documentation control.
  • Experience working on large-scale industrial, commercial, manufacturing, infrastructure, or construction projects.
  • Excellent communication and leadership skills.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and quality reporting systems.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Construction Management, Quality Management, or related field.
  • ASQ certifications or other relevant quality certifications.
  • Experience supporting EPC, industrial, manufacturing, or mission-critical construction projects.
  • ISO quality management experience.
  • CWI, NACE, or related industry certifications are a plus.
